Types of Leather Couches
When looking for the ideal leather couch, comprehending the different kinds of leather is important. Below is a table that lays out the main kinds of leather used in couch manufacturing:
Type of LeatherDescriptionProsConsFull-Grain LeatherThe highest quality leather, made from the top layer of the conceal. Natural flaws show up.Incredibly long lasting; establishes a patina; high-end aesthetic.Expensive; might show scratches gradually.Top-Grain LeatherSlightly sanded to remove flaws, making it more consistent in look.Long lasting and stain-resistant; luxurious feel.Less breathable than full-grain; may not develop a patina.Corrected Grain LeatherCoated with synthetic finishes to hide imperfections.Budget-friendly; consistent look; much easier to clean up.Less breathable; lower quality; does not have natural texture.Bonded LeatherMade from leftover leather scraps and bonded with polyurethane.Affordable; looks like leather.Not as durable; might peel over time.Suede LeatherSoft leather made from the underside of the animal conceal.Soft texture; distinct appearance.Spots easily; less long lasting than other leathers.Advantages of Leather Couches

Maintenance Tips for Leather Couches
While leather couches are simpler to keep than their material equivalents, they still need some routine maintenance. Here are important suggestions for keeping a leather couch in prime condition:

Regular Dusting: Use a soft, dry cloth to get rid of dust and dirt. Prevent using abrasive products that can scratch the surface area.

Conditioning: Apply a leather conditioner every 6-12 months to keep the leather flexible and avoid splitting.

Spot Cleaning: For stains, use a damp fabric and big sale on sofas moderate soap. Avoid harsh chemicals that can damage the leather.

Avoid Direct Sunlight: Place your leather couch away from direct sunlight to avoid fading and drying out.

Usage Protectants: Consider using a leather protectant spray to protect against spills and discolorations.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. For how long do leather couches last?
Leather couches can last anywhere from 10 to 30 years, depending on the quality of the leather and how well they are maintained.
2. Is leather furniture worth the investment?
Many individuals discover that leather furnishings deserves the investment due to its durability, timeless appeal, and ease of maintenance.
3. Can leather couches be repaired if harmed?
Yes, many minor damages can be fixed, such as little scratches or tears. Nevertheless, it's finest to seek advice from a professional for substantial damage.
4. How do I prevent leather from splitting?
Regular conditioning and keeping the couch away from direct sunlight can help avoid cracking.
5. Exist eco-friendly leather alternatives available?
Yes, there are eco-friendly leather options, like vegetable-tanned leather, which uses natural compounds for tanning rather of chemicals.
